Output e4a6ea18974b68dfdde8865508f88c08f25695e7abca306f643d97b3003df7f0:0

value
518357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9991cd3cf521eb6c8696684bf1150959bb4b3e65 OP_EQUAL
address
3Fh1yNfSuzYPfxzjEDQXMFgC7em8C1Sci8
transaction
e4a6ea18974b68dfdde8865508f88c08f25695e7abca306f643d97b3003df7f0
confirmations
263250
spent
true